With clinical trials conducted in 100+ countries and ongoing development of novel frameworks for clinical research through our PPD clinical research portfolio, our work spans laboratory, digital and decentralized clinical trial services. Responsibilities

  • Create Targets: Supports with developing and actioning the integrated account plan. Review client pipelines and identify strategic targets; Identify gaps in intelligence & create actions; Create targeted engagement plans for opening market penetration; Use the support of Account Development/Business insights to reach out to targets; Responsible for engaging with expanded contacts in selected accounts
  • Client Engagement: Establishes centralized, professional messaging to be communicated regularly to customers to enhance their customer experience and partnership communication; Ensure selective process that influences decisions for partnership opportunities; Engage with clients to open new opportunities; Ensures effective and aligned integration of improvements and internal delivery of lessons learned/intelligence in new partnership opportunities: Increasing intelligence from conferences
  • Conversion and Transition: Deliver Partnership/RFP/RFI’s through conscientious approaches embracing the collective organizations capabilities; Create systematic, thorough groundwork for transitions with account teams; Enhances partnership implementation & maintenance activities. Works closely with partnership implementation teams to ensure best practice implementation for effective transition planning through the relationship handoff, from change management to execution.
  • Analytics: Ensure delivery of data packs and analysis to support client engagement: Works cross-functionally to continue to improve and leverage existing technologies and ensure resources are utilized for effective partner engagement.
